The Role of In-App Purchases and Advertisements

A significant revenue stream for many free-to-play mobile games comes from in-app purchases and advertisements. The chicken road game is no exception. Players are often presented with options to purchase in-game currency, which can be used to unlock new chicken skins, revive the chicken after a collision, or remove advertisements temporarily. The presence of these monetization strategies isn't inherently problematic, but the way they are implemented can influence player perception.

Aggressive advertising, frequent prompts to purchase, or pay-to-win mechanics can create a negative user experience. If players feel pressured to spend money to enjoy the game fully, it can erode trust in the game’s legitimacy. A balanced approach, where in-app purchases are optional and don’t provide an unfair advantage, is essential for maintaining a positive reputation. The game’s reliance on ads can also contribute to a feeling that the experience is constantly interrupted, leading to dissatisfaction.

Monetization StrategyPotential Impact on Player Experience
In-App Purchases (Cosmetic Items)Generally positive, allowing for personalization without affecting gameplay.
In-App Purchases (Revives/Power-Ups)Can be negative if it creates a pay-to-win scenario.
Frequent AdvertisementsHighly negative, disrupts gameplay and can be intrusive.
Rewarded Video Ads (Optional)Generally positive, provides players with a choice to watch ads for benefits.

Understanding how these monetization strategies are implemented is crucial for assessing the chicken road game’s fair play aspects. A game that prioritizes player enjoyment over maximizing revenue is more likely to be perceived as legitimate.

Examining the Game's Code and Data Practices (Where Possible)

For technically inclined individuals, examining the game’s code (if accessible) and data practices can provide deeper insights into its mechanics. Reverse engineering the game’s code can reveal how the traffic patterns are generated, whether there are any hidden algorithms designed to manipulate difficulty, or how in-app purchases are implemented. However, it is essential to note that reverse engineering may be prohibited by the game’s terms of service.

Analyzing the game's data practices – how it collects, stores, and uses player data – is also crucial. Responsible game developers adhere to strict privacy policies and obtain explicit consent from players before collecting personal information. Suspicious data collection practices or a lack of transparency regarding data usage can raise privacy concerns and cast doubt on the game’s legitimacy. The collection of excessive and unnecessary data isn't just a privacy issue; it may be a signal of improper coding or an attempt to manipulate player behavior.

Tools and Techniques for Assessing Game Integrity

While full code analysis is often beyond the reach of the average player, several tools and techniques can be used to assess a game’s integrity. Network analysis tools can be used to monitor the game’s network traffic, revealing how it communicates with servers and what data is being exchanged. This can help identify potential security vulnerabilities or suspicious activity. Memory editors can be used to examine the game's memory during runtime, potentially revealing hidden variables or algorithms.

However, it’s crucial to proceed with caution when using these tools. Tampering with a game’s code or memory can violate its terms of service and potentially lead to account suspension. Moreover, interpreting the results of these analyses requires a strong technical understanding.
